| Remarks | The object was extremely bright and large, and upon what I assume was impact I could see very distant yet VERY bright purple, green and pink flashes which lasted for a good couple of seconds; maybe two or three seconds. I only saw it through my bedroom window, so I caught the last glimpse, a good 5 or 6 seconds of the whole thing. |
